Understanding Webhook vs API Automation Basics

At its core, webhook vs API automation boils down to push versus pull models. Both power seamless data flow, but they operate differently in automation ecosystems.

What Are Webhooks in Automation?

Webhooks act as event-driven messengers, automatically sending data to a designated URL when a trigger occurs—like a new sale or user signup. This push-based approach ensures real-time delivery without constant checking. In 2025, webhooks are evolving with enhanced security protocols, such as HMAC signatures for tamper-proof payloads, making them ideal for low-latency automations.

API Calls: The Pull Powerhouse for Automation

API calls, on the other hand, require your system to actively request data from a server—think querying a database for updates. They’re versatile for bidirectional exchanges and complex queries but demand polling for real-time needs, which can spike server loads. Recent API standards like GraphQL 2025 updates now support subscription models, blending pull efficiency with near-push responsiveness.

Pros and Cons: Webhook vs API Automation Showdown

Deciding on webhook vs API automation? Weigh these factors for your use case.

AspectWebhooks (Push)API Calls (Pull)
SpeedInstant event triggers; minimal latencyOn-demand, but polling adds delays
EfficiencyReduces unnecessary requests; server-friendlyFlexible for bulk data; higher overhead if frequent
VersatilityOne-way notifications; event-specificBidirectional; handles queries, auth, and more
DebuggingTricky—events are unpredictableEasier to test with direct requests
SecurityExposes endpoints; needs robust validationBuilt-in auth like OAuth; more control

Webhooks shine in reactive automations, like instant alerts, while APIs dominate proactive data pulls, such as reporting dashboards.

When to Choose Webhook vs API Automation

  • Opt for Webhooks in webhook vs API automation when real-time matters: Notifications, live dashboards, or event streams (e.g., PickMyTrade trades).
  • Go with APIs for depth: Analytics queries, user auth, or scheduled syncs where flexibility rules.
  • Hybrid Wins: Use APIs for setup and webhooks for ongoing events, as in Strapi’s May 2025 workflows.

Best Practices for Seamless Webhook vs API Automation

  1. Secure Everything: Implement signatures for webhooks and token rotation for APIs.
  2. Handle Failures Gracefully: Add retries and queues—vital post-2025’s webhook surge in microservices.
  3. Monitor & Scale: Tools like RudderStack track webhook vs API automation performance in real-time.
  4. Test Rigorously: Simulate events for webhooks; mock endpoints for APIs.

Frequently Asked Questions (FAQs)

What is the main difference between webhooks and API calls in automation?

Webhooks push data automatically on events, while APIs pull data via requests—ideal for real-time vs on-demand needs.

When should I use webhooks over APIs for automation?

Choose webhooks for instant updates like alerts or trades; APIs suit complex queries or bulk data.

Can webhooks and APIs be used together in automation workflows?

Yes! APIs handle initial setup, webhooks manage events—hybrids power 2025’s top integrations.

Are webhooks more secure than APIs in automation?

Not inherently—both need auth. Webhooks require endpoint protection; APIs leverage OAuth for bidirectional safety.
